Colle Spineta
Colle Spineta is a peak in Avola, Syracuse, Sicily and has an elevation of 460 metres. Colle Spineta is situated nearby to the locality Contrada Porcari, as well as near Contrada Bellicci.Places of Interest

Netum
Archaeological site
Photo: Codas,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Netum or Neetum, was a considerable ancient town in the south of Sicily, near the sources of the little river Asinarus, and about 34 km southwest of Syracuse. Its current site is at the località of Noto Antica, in the modern comune of Noto.
